Running BIST
Steps
1. Turn off your computer.
2. On the back panel of the desktop, press the Power-Supply Diagnostics button.
3. Perform the following steps based on the conditions indicated.
Table 11. Troubleshooting steps
Conditions Inference Next Steps
The LED indicator displays a solid color
without flickering or flashing
and
the power-supply fan runs on a normal
speed.
The power supply unit can deliver power
to the computer, but something else is
impeding the POST process.
You can carry on further diagnosis by
checking the power button. If there is no
issue with the power button, proceed to
No POST troubleshooting.
The LED indicator displays a solid color
without flickering or flashing
or
the power-supply fan runs on a normal
speed.
The power supply unit cannot deliver
power to the computer, and the problem
could be caused by any component
connected to the power supply unit, or
the power supply unit itself.
You can disconnect parts from the power
supply unit to isolate the source of the
power failure, and proceed to No Power
troubleshooting.
Recovering the operating system
When your computer is unable to boot to the operating system even after repeated attempts, it automatically starts Dell
SupportAssist OS Recovery.
Dell SupportAssist OS Recovery is a standalone tool that is preinstalled in all Dell computers installed with Windows operating
system. It consists of tools to diagnose and troubleshoot issues that may occur before your computer boots to the operating system. It
enables you to diagnose hardware issues, repair your computer, back up your files, or restore your computer to its factory state.
You can also download it from the Dell Support website to troubleshoot and fix your computer when it fails to boot into their primary
operating system due to software or hardware failures.
For more information about the Dell SupportAssist OS Recovery, see Dell SupportAssist OS Recovery User's Guide at
www.dell.com/
serviceabilitytools. Click SupportAssist and then, click SupportAssist OS Recovery.
WiFi power cycle
About this task
If your computer is unable to access the internet due to WiFi connectivity issues a WiFi power cycle procedure may be performed.
The following procedure provides the instructions on how to conduct a WiFi power cycle:
NOTE: Some ISPs (Internet Service Providers) provide a modem/router combo device.
Steps
1. Turn off your computer.
2. Turn off the modem.
3. Turn off the wireless router.
4. Wait for 30 seconds.
5. Turn on the wireless router.
6. Turn on the modem.
7. Turn on your computer.
